A well-established and growing organization in the consumer goods sector is seeking a Corporate Recruiter to join our Talent team. This is a confidential opportunity for a strategic recruiting professional who brings experience across corporate functions, HR collaboration, and offer negotiations.
You will be responsible for identifying top talent, building sustainable pipelines, and driving key hiring initiatives while contributing to strategic HR projects that enhance organizational effectiveness.
Key Responsibilities- Manage full-cycle recruitment for corporate functions such as HR, Finance, Merchandising, Marketing, and Supply Chain
- Deliver a high-touch candidate experience while coaching hiring managers on best practices
- Build and maintain strong pipelines of passive and active candidates through proactive sourcing, networking, and relationship management
- Partner with department leaders to develop talent strategies aligned with workforce planning and business goals
- Lead offer development and negotiation processes, ensuring alignment with compensation structures and internal equity
- Support HR initiatives such as onboarding enhancements, workforce planning, strategies, and talent assessments
- Utilize data to report on recruiting activity, pipeline health, time-to-fill, and source effectiveness
- Represent the company at select industry events and virtual recruiting forums
- 5+ years of corporate recruiting experience, with proven success filling roles across multiple business functions
- Background in HR or experience partnering closely with HR teams on talent strategy and initiatives
- Strong understanding of compensation principles and experience managing offer negotiations
- Track record of building and sustaining talent pipelines for strategic, hard-to-fill roles
- Highly organized with excellent attention to detail, especially in process documentation and compliance
- Exceptional communication, relationship-building, and influencing skills
- Proficiency with ATS platforms and sourcing tools (e.g., Linked In Recruiter, Workday, Greenhouse, etc.)
-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business, or related field preferred
